Full-time: Bremen 2-1 Wolfsburg

The visitors took the lead through Svanberg but couldn't build on it after the restart. Bremen came out for the second half showing plenty of hunger. They were rewarded with two dramatic late goals from Stage and Mbangula to secure their third successive Bundesliga win at home.

Half-time: Bremen 0-1 Wolfsburg

The visitors will certainly be the happier of the two teams. Wolfsburg withstanded early pressure from the hosts which saw Pieper force Grabara into an early save. VfL then had an excellent chance through Daghim before Svanberg broke the deadlock with an excellent finish. Arnold and Eriksen then tested Backhaus as they went in search for a second.

Captain staying on board

Wolfsburg announced a day ahead of the clash that club captain Maximilian Arnold has extended his contract with the club to 2028. Arnold has been with the Wolves since 2009 and is their record appearance holder (with 458 appearances in all competitions).

Seizing the Stage

Jens Stage was Bremen's top scorer last season with ten strikes and leads the club's goalscoring figures so far in the new campaign with three goals.

One to avoid

Defeat would see Wolfsburg equal the club's worst-ever start to a Bundesliga season with eight points from their opening ten games - set back in 2012/13.
camera-photo

Ship steadied

After a mixed start to the season, Werder Bremen are unbeaten in their past four and have a chance to climb up to seventh, on Friday evening at least, with a win.

Happy travellers

Wolfsburg have won on four of their past five visits to Bremen - in total clocking more away wins against Werder than any other Bundesliga outfit (13).
